Output 21aa8915b359424d539c20b06da81461b270ce91cc7d5ed3290266ed3fb04afd:0

value
46631904
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f2ad354b6724dd9a092621fdef3f81dc9bca7638 OP_EQUALVERIFY OP_CHECKSIG
address
1P8A292dfpctmQteBsXQzhy5itDnfuMgca
transaction
21aa8915b359424d539c20b06da81461b270ce91cc7d5ed3290266ed3fb04afd
confirmations
559953
spent
true